Traverseon Coffee Maker Delivers Café-Quality Espresso Anywhere
The Traverseon High-pressure Brewing Portable Coffee Maker brings the experience of rich, café-quality espresso to any location. Designed for travelers, outdoor adventurers, and anyone who wants a great shot without being tied to a kitchen, it combines portability, versatility, and power in one compact unit. The 19-bar calibrated pressure system ensures every extraction delivers full flavor density and a golden crema, matching the depth and aroma you expect from your favorite coffee shop.
Flexibility is built in. This 2-in-1 brewer works with both ground coffee and Nespresso® capsules, letting you switch between the convenience of pods and the custom flavors of freshly ground beans. Whether you are in a rush before a meeting or relaxing on a weekend getaway, it adapts to your brewing style. The ability to use hot or cold water adds even more versatility. Add 50 ml of hot water for an instant shot or let the integrated heating element bring cold water to brewing temperature, supporting both single and double shots with ease.
Power comes from a 7500 mAh battery that delivers up to 200 extractions per charge, with USB-C charging for quick top-ups from a laptop, car outlet, or power bank. At only 1.8 lbs, it is light enough to carry on hiking trails, pack in a cabin bag, or keep at your desk for an afternoon pick-me-up.
Practicality extends to cleaning and safety. The fully detachable design makes rinsing simple, preventing oil buildup and keeping flavors fresh. Constructed from BPA-free, high-temperature-resistant materials, it preserves the taste of your coffee while ensuring safe use over time.
